Just understand that the type of cleats you buy now will probably be with you for a LONG LONG time. Once you get used to a cleat, you invest in shoes, pedals, cleats, and you'll find that switching costs are high and you'll be riding them for 20 years. So pick carefully. I ride SPD's.
